Abstract
Bone augmentation before treatment with endosseous implants is a common procedure for rehabilitation of the edentulous jaw. Both machined and surface modified implants have been used in one-stage and two-stage surgery protocols with varying results and survival rates. The influence of surface modification on the integration of implants has been documented in both non-grafted and grafted bone. The aim of this study was to compare the integration and stability of surface modified fluoridated vs. machined implants when placed simultaneously with an onlay bone graft.
